Incident Overview

On a significant day for advocates of immigration reform, Reps. Rob Menendez Jr., Bonnie Watson Coleman, and LaMonica McIver entered the ICE facility in Newark on Friday. Accompanied by protesters, the lawmakers gained entry by rushing through the gates just as an ICE bus was entering. This act of civil disobedience resulted in them being temporarily held at the first security checkpoint of the facility, indicating the palpable tension between local lawmakers and federal authorities over immigration enforcement practices.

The actions of these legislators highlight the aggressive tactics being used to voice opposition to current immigration laws, which many see as detrimental to vulnerable populations. In this case, their immediate goal was to conduct an “oversight visit” into the conditions and practices within the detention center. Arrests and Legal Ramifications

During the chaotic scene at Delaney Hall, Newark’s mayor, Ras Baraka, was arrested for trespassing as he attempted to join the lawmakers in their protest. The actions of the mayor, who is also a prominent Democratic gubernatorial candidate, pose serious implications for his political career amidst calls for accountability in immigration practices. Responses from Lawmakers and Activists

In the wake of this incident, responses have poured in from a variety of stakeholders. The White House condemned the actions of the lawmakers, stating that they are “crossing the line” into unlawful behavior. A White House spokesman, Kush Desai, articulated the administration’s view that the Democrats are prioritizing the interests of illegal immigrants over those of American citizens, heightening political tensions in an already divisive arena.

On the other hand, local activists argue that their efforts to gain access to ICE facilities are necessary for ensuring transparency and accountability in the treatment of detainees. They maintain that without oversight, illegal activities could go unchecked, leading to potential human rights violations. Claims of Improper Conduct at Delaney Hall

Recent allegations made by local officials assert that the GEO Group, which operates the Delaney Hall facility, has been denying lawful entry to safety inspectors. A lawsuit filed by the City of Newark claims that the GEO Group has failed to comply with required permitting, including performing unregulated renovations at the facility. These claims suggest potential violations of city construction codes that, if proven true, could have legal ramifications for the facility operators.

The Department of Homeland Security (DHS) has denied these allegations, asserting that they are false. This back-and-forth illustrates the complexities involved in oversight and regulation within detention centers and adds layers of context to the ongoing protests.
